Voyage autour de mon jardin (Journey Around My Garden) by Alphonse Karr, published in 1851, is a reflective and lyrical exploration of the author’s garden, blending natural observation with philosophical musings, social commentary, and personal anecdotes.

Written as a series of letters to a friend who has embarked on a grand world tour, Karr contrasts the friend’s pursuit of exotic experiences with the wonders found in the microcosm of his own garden. Through vivid descriptions of plants, insects, and seasonal changes, he reveals the beauty and complexity of the natural world, from the delicate struggles of spiders to the vibrant colors of flowers like the heliotrope and julienne.

Karr interweaves stories of human emotion—love, loss, and nostalgia—such as the tale of Edmond and Noémi, whose unfulfilled love is rediscovered in old age.

The work critiques the human tendency to seek novelty abroad while overlooking the marvels at home, celebrating the garden as a source of eternal renewal and profound insight.
